Добавление нескольких "Объектов" из одной таблицы в другую

Статус
В этой теме нельзя размещать новые ответы.

mrleonkz

Посетитель
Добрый времени суток,
Столкнулся с такой проблемой, создаю базу для выполнения заявок на поставку товаров. Основанием для приобретения является заявка от подразделения (на данный момент 23 подразделения, но они постоянно меняются), но есть заявки общие для всех подразделений и по каждому надо сделать ссылку в форме "Заявка". Отдельная таблица содержит список подразделений, в таблице заявка приходится вставлять 23 объекта в которых отмечаются подразделения, очень не удобно. При этом сложность еще в том что поле фильтр распространяется на все 23 объекта и фактически перестает приносить пользу. Возможно есть решения для данного случая. Заранее благодарен за ответ
 

Vladimir

Администратор
Команда форума
Добрый день.
Можете приложить проект для лучшего понимания вопроса?
Можно упрощённый вариант и без данных.
 

mrleonkz

Посетитель
Доброго времени суток,
Добавил файл. Таблица "Заявка" по предыдущему посту. В дополнении еще вопрос, таблица "Контрагенты" имеет поле метки, где описываются сфера услуг конкретного поставщика. В фильтре отображаются все метки но нет поиска по ним, возможно ли применить поиск в данном фильтре. Заранее благодарен.

Vladimir: Ваш приложенный проект удалили, так как содержит конфиденциальную информацию.
 
Последнее редактирование модератором:

Vladimir

Администратор
Команда форума
Надо использовать форму связи, в которой добавляется дочерний список подразделений, подписанных на заявку.
Сначала создать дополнительный объект, который будет содержать ссылки на объект подразделений ("Список подразделений").
На базе объекта "Заявки" создаётся форма связи, в которой добавляется дочерний объект с подразделениями.
Список подразделений для записи заявки.png
При добавлении подчинённого объекта (не равнозначного), в нём автоматически создаётся поле ссылки на родительский объект, по которой можно вытянуть все данные этого объекта (через поля ссылок на поля).
Автоматически создаваемое поле ссылки на родительский объект.png
Теперь на базе объекта "Список подразделений" создаётся форма связи "Подразделения в заявках", в которой для поля "Подразделение" устанавливается свойство перехода к одноимённому объекту, а для поля "Заявка" - переход к форме "Заявки". Это даёт возможность по правой кнопке в списке, или в детализации записи, перейти непосредственно к нужной записи в нужном объекте/форме.
Переходы к формам и объектам в списке и в детализации.png
В проекте произведены дополнительные настройки с отображением полей и вкладок на формах.
Если есть вопросы - уточняйте.

Пример проекта в приложении.
 

Вложения

  • Использование дочернего объекта.rpr
    1.9 KB · Просмотры: 217
Последнее редактирование:

Vladimir

Администратор
Команда форума
В дополнении еще вопрос, таблица "Контрагенты" имеет поле метки, где описываются сфера услуг конкретного поставщика. В фильтре отображаются все метки но нет поиска по ним, возможно ли применить поиск в данном фильтре.
Фильтр по данным в полях метки.png

Записали данное замечание и фильтр по данным в полях реализуем в следующей версии конструктора, которая сейчас готовится. В ней будет добавлено много новых инструментов, кардинально изменён внешний вид и переработана внутренняя работа по сети. В 5-ой версии мы лишь вносим исправления ошибок, копируя их в новую.
 

mrleonkz

Посетитель
Спасибо, существенно помогло. Подскажите ориентировочный срок выхода новой версии конструктора?
 
Статус
В этой теме нельзя размещать новые ответы.
Сверху Снизу